Campground Name:
Natchez Trace Pin Oak Campground
Administered by National Forest / Park/ State:
Tennessee
Specific Agency:
State Agency
Directions to Natchez Trace Pin Oak Campground:
From Jct of I-40 & SR-114 (exit 116), S 11.4 mi on SR-114 (R) (Follow Signs For RV Camping)
Camping Season:
Open all year (As the season may vary from year-to-year and based on conditions please check before visiting)
Number and Type of Campsites:
Available: 79 Gravel: 79 22 pull-thrus(30 x 60) Back-ins(25 x 60) Patios Some shaded Room for slide outs
Other Features and Amenities:
Restrooms and Showers Public Phone Laundry 5 Rental Units Church Services Table at Site BBQ at Site Nature Trails
Internet and Wireless Access:
no
Trailer and RV Hook-ups:
Full hookups (79) 30/50 Amps No side-by-side hookups
